Implementing BDI-like Systems by Direct Execution

نویسنده

  • Michael Fisher
چکیده

While the Belief, Desire, Intention (BDI) framework is one of the most influential and appealing approaches to rational agent architectures, a gulf often exists between the high-level BDI model and its practical realisation. In contrast, the Concurrent METATEM language, being based upon executable formal specifications, presents a close link between the theory and implementation, yet lacks some of the features considered central to the representation of rational agents. In this paper, we introduce a hybrid approach combining the direct execution of Concurrent METATEM with elements of rationality from the BDI framework. We show how this system can capture a range of agent behaviours, while retaining many of the advantages of executable specifications.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Plexil-Like Plan Execution Control in Agent Programming

BDI-based agent programming languages are well-known technologies for implementing autonomous agents in dynamic environments. Supporting robot programming however requires the plan representation and execution control capabilities of these languages to be extended for 1-) controlling and monitoring the execution of actions in complex arrangements and 2-) coordinating the parallel execution of p...

متن کامل

An Ontology Driven, Procedural Reasoning System-Like Agent Model, For Multi-Agent Based Mobile Workforce Brokering Systems

Problem statement: It has been proven that Believe, Desire, Intention (BDI) agent architecture, performs suitably in dynamic and unpredictable environments. Although BDI architecture has been formulated rigorously, implementing BDI architecture is not as straightforward as it has been promised. Nevertheless, the preeminent implementation of BDI architecture is Procedural Reasoning System (PRS) ...

متن کامل

Towards a Jason Infrastructure for Soccer Playing Agents

AgentSpeak and its practical interpreter Jason represent an excellent framework for implementing complex, reasoning agents. This paper discusses an ongoing research dedicated to extending Jason with the support for soccer playing agents. The end goal is to design an efficient infrastructure, capable of deploying and running BDI agents in the RoboCup soccer simulation league. 1 Intelligent agent...

متن کامل

Reasoning about preferences in BDI agent systems

BDI agents often have to make decisions about which plan is used to achieve a goal, and in which order goals are to be achieved. In this paper we describe how to incorporate preferences (based on the LPP language) into the BDI execution model.

متن کامل

CAMP-BDI: A Pre-emptive Approach for Plan Execution Robustness in Multiagent Systems

Failure mitigation during plan execution an important component in BDI agent robustness. In realistic environments exogenous change may increase likelihood of activity failure, threatening intended plans and associated goals. Failure itself may incur debilitative consequences or costs, hindering typical reactive recovery and potentially threatening future goals. We argue proactive failure mitig...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 1997